Output 842959c50d1d7f1e6abd055b0742cb94d8a653e058263d3c259622085bfc1c8f:7

value
343225
script pubkey
OP_0 OP_PUSHBYTES_20 1c34c7ace81c7a68773350b212d0f12c12cabe16
address
bc1qrs6v0t8gr3axsaen2zep95839sfv40skfjdqz8
transaction
842959c50d1d7f1e6abd055b0742cb94d8a653e058263d3c259622085bfc1c8f